Management vs Restoration: Knowing the Difference
It's helpful to think of your hair journey in two distinct phases: management and restoration. Management involves maintenance therapies like Platelet-Rich Plasma (PRP) or Growth Factor Concentrate (GFC). These treatments are fantastic for supporting your existing hairs and slowing down the thinning process, but they can't bring back what's already gone. They act like a high-quality fertiliser for a garden that's still growing. Restoration, on the other hand, is the physical relocation of follicles that are genetically resistant to DHT, the hormone responsible for male pattern baldness.
This specialised surgical technique relies on the principle of donor dominance. Hairs taken from the back and sides of your head are "hard-wired" to grow for a lifetime, regardless of where they're moved. Whilst maintenance therapies keep your current hair healthy, restoration fills the gaps. A sophisticated aesthetic result usually comes from a combination of both; we restore the hairline with new hairs and manage the surrounding area to prevent future thinning.

The Science of Permanence: Why Direct Hair Implantation Lasts
The foundation of any reputable permanent hair loss clinic lies in a biological principle known as "Donor Dominance." If you look at most men experiencing thinning, you'll notice that the hair on the back and sides of the head usually remains thick and healthy. These specific hairs are genetically programmed to resist the effects of Dihydrotestosterone (DHT), the hormone responsible for shrinking follicles. Understanding hair follicle development and regeneration is key to appreciating why these hairs remain permanent even after they are relocated to the top of the scalp. Once they are moved, they retain their genetic "memory" and continue to grow for a lifetime.

Comparing Permanent Restoration to Maintenance Therapies
Deciding on a therapy often feels like a balancing act between immediate cost and long-term longevity. Maintenance therapies like Platelet-Rich Plasma (PRP) and Growth Factor Concentrate (GFC) offer excellent support for existing hairs, but they aren't a final solution for areas where the scalp is already visible. A specialised permanent hair loss clinic focuses on the physical relocation of follicles, whereas maintenance therapies simply nourish what you already have. For those dealing with hereditary-pattern baldness, understanding that non-surgical options cannot "grow" hair on a completely smooth scalp is vital for managing expectations. The Limitations of Topical and Oral Medications
Many patients arrive at our clinic after years of using oral medications or foams. Whilst these can be effective for some, they require a lifetime commitment; if you stop the treatment, the results often vanish within months. The "shedding phase" often associated with these chemical treatments can also trigger significant anxiety for men already worried about their appearance. Transitioning from "hiding" your thinning to "fixing" it permanently allows you to step away from the cycle of daily chemical applications. It is a shift from managing a condition to reclaiming your natural hairline for good.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is the hair restoration truly permanent?
Yes, the results are permanent because we use follicles that are genetically resistant to the hormones that cause thinning. These hairs are harvested from the "donor area" at the back of your head, where they are biologically programmed to grow for a lifetime. Even after they are moved to a new location, they retain this genetic resilience and continue their natural growth cycle indefinitely.
How many hairs will I need for a full restoration?
The exact number of hairs depends entirely on the size of the thinning area and your desired density. A minor refinement of the hairline might require the placement of 1,500 to 2,000 hairs, whilst more extensive restoration can involve 4,000 hairs or more. We determine the precise requirement during a digital scalp analysis to ensure we achieve a result that looks both thick and natural.
What is the recovery time after a procedure at a permanent hair loss clinic?
Most patients are able to return to their professional routine within two to three days. Because the DHI technique is minimally invasive and requires no scalpels or stitches, the healing process is remarkably swift. You may notice some slight redness in the first 48 hours, but this typically fades quickly, allowing for a very discreet recovery process.
